Italian broadcast powerhouse Mediaset will unveil an around-the-clock news channel that will start operations this year, company president Fedele Confalonieri said Tuesday.
Confalonieri, speaking at the 26th meeting of Italy's leading editors union near Milan, said the channel will be part of the new News Mediaset unit and will be based on a partnership between Mediaset and a major international publishing and news organization. He did not provide further details.

Syfy, the cable channel behind such series as "Warehouse 13" and the "Ghost Hunters" reality shows, is getting into the movie business.
The channel, part of NBC Universal, said Wednesday it will join with sister company Universal Pictures to release one to two films a year with budgets between $5 million and $25 million starting in 2012. The joint venture will be called Syfy Films.

Celebrities including Robert Redford, Robert De Niro, and Sting have called on Iran to release a woman sentenced to death by stoning for adultery.
In an open letter published Monday, more than 80 actors, artists, musicians, academics and politicians said that "Sakineh Mohammadi Ashtiani has suffered enough."
